Exact Editions provides access to digital books at the APA Eastern Conference 7–13 January

The Eastern Division is one of three divisions of the American Philosophical Association, along with the Central and Pacific Divisions. Each year the division holds an annual business meeting early January. During the pandemic, the Eastern Division will be held as part of a virtual divisional meeting on Friday, January 15, 2021 at 1 p.m. Eastern time.

The British Museum Magazine joins Exact Editions

Exact Editions is delighted to announce that new digital resource, The British Museum Magazine, will now be available to institutions. Subscribers will have access to the museum’s membership magazine which currently stretches back to the Autumn/Winter 2006 issue, and includes over 50 back issues to explore, with the full archive due to be added at a later date.
